Accumulation Mode
The type of accumulation mode is displayed here. The mode can be
Manual
,
Single
, or
Repeat
.
•
Accumulation Period
For single and repeat accumulation modes, the accumulation period
is displayed here. The period will be displayed in elapsed seconds,
error count, or bit count, depending on the selected method.
Burst Results
The recommended application for burst mode is to measure multiple
data bursts in quick succession. In this way, you can accumulate data
for all bursts together. You may wish to accumulate the number of bits
necessary for a statistically valid BER measurement. Refer to
“Introduction to Burst Sync Mode” on page 144
When the accumulation period lasts for the duration of all bursts, the
gaps in error counting (while the Gate In signal was high) will not be
included in BER calculations. The gaps in error counting will not be
considered error-free periods.
N O T E
If the gaps between data bursts are greater than 1 second (or 100 ms in the
measurement log file), they may be visible in the accumulated results graph.
•
Burst Status
The following states may be returned:
– No Error
No burst errors have occurred (any of those listed below).
– Gate Signal Too Long
This error can occur if there are too many bits within a burst. The
limit is 4 Gbit. At 13 Gb/s, this occurs roughly after 0.3 s (slower
frequencies have a higher gate-in period). This error has a higher
priority than "no unique 48bits".
– No Unique 48 Bits Found
For reliable synchronization, a pattern must contain a unique 48-
bit pattern (the detect word). If the current pattern does not have
a detect word, this error occurs.
